C# Class MonoDevelop.VersionControl.VersionControlService

ファイルを表示 Open project: powerumc/monodevelop_korean Class Usage Examples

Private Properties

Property Type Description
DelayedSaveComments void
GetCommitComment string
GetCommitComments System.Collections.Hashtable
GetConfiguration MonoDevelop.VersionControl.VersionControlConfiguration
GetStatusMonitor MonoDevelop.Core.ProgressMonitor
NotifyAfterCommit void
NotifyBeforeCommit void
NotifyPrepareCommit void
OnEntryAdded void
OnExtensionChanged void
OnFileAdded void
SaveComments void
SetCommitComment void
ShouldAddFile bool
SolutionItemAddFile void
SolutionItemAddFiles void
VersionControlService System

Public Methods

Method Description
AddRepository ( Repository repo ) : void
CheckVersionControlInstalled ( ) : bool
GetCommitMessageFormat ( MonoDevelop.VersionControl.ChangeSet cset, MonoDevelop.Projects.AuthorInformation &authorInfo ) : MonoDevelop.VersionControl.CommitMessageFormat
GetCommitMessageFormat ( MonoDevelop.Projects.SolutionFolderItem item ) : MonoDevelop.VersionControl.CommitMessageFormat
GetProgressMonitor ( string operation ) : MonoDevelop.Core.ProgressMonitor
GetProgressMonitor ( string operation, VersionControlOperationType op ) : MonoDevelop.Core.ProgressMonitor
GetRepositories ( ) : IEnumerable
GetRepository ( WorkspaceObject entry ) : Repository
GetRepositoryReference ( string path, string id ) : Repository
GetStatusLabel ( VersionStatus status ) : string
GetVersionControlSystems ( ) : IEnumerable
IsSolutionDisabled ( Solution it ) : bool
LoadIconForStatus ( VersionStatus status ) : Xwt.Drawing.Image
LoadOverlayIconForStatus ( VersionStatus status ) : Xwt.Drawing.Image
NotifyFileStatusChanged ( MonoDevelop.VersionControl.FileUpdateEventArgs args ) : void
NotifyFileStatusChanged ( IEnumerable items ) : void
RemoveRepository ( Repository repo ) : void
ResetConfiguration ( ) : void
SaveConfiguration ( ) : void
SetSolutionDisabled ( Solution it, bool value ) : void

Private Methods

Method Description
DelayedSaveComments ( object ob ) : void
GetCommitComment ( string file ) : string
GetCommitComments ( ) : Hashtable
GetConfiguration ( ) : MonoDevelop.VersionControl.VersionControlConfiguration
GetStatusMonitor ( ) : MonoDevelop.Core.ProgressMonitor
NotifyAfterCommit ( Repository repo, MonoDevelop.VersionControl.ChangeSet changeSet, bool success ) : void
NotifyBeforeCommit ( Repository repo, MonoDevelop.VersionControl.ChangeSet changeSet ) : void
NotifyPrepareCommit ( Repository repo, MonoDevelop.VersionControl.ChangeSet changeSet ) : void
OnEntryAdded ( object o, MonoDevelop.Projects.SolutionItemEventArgs args ) : void
OnExtensionChanged ( object s, Mono.Addins.ExtensionNodeEventArgs args ) : void
OnFileAdded ( object s, MonoDevelop.Projects.ProjectFileEventArgs e ) : void
SaveComments ( ) : void
SetCommitComment ( string file, string comment, bool save ) : void
ShouldAddFile ( ProjectFileEventInfo info ) : bool
SolutionItemAddFile ( string rootPath, HashSet files, string file ) : void
SolutionItemAddFiles ( string rootPath, MonoDevelop.Projects.SolutionFolderItem entry, HashSet files ) : void
VersionControlService ( ) : System

Method Details

AddRepository() public static method

public static AddRepository ( Repository repo ) : void
repo Repository
return void

CheckVersionControlInstalled() public static method

public static CheckVersionControlInstalled ( ) : bool
return bool

GetCommitMessageFormat() public static method

public static GetCommitMessageFormat ( MonoDevelop.VersionControl.ChangeSet cset, MonoDevelop.Projects.AuthorInformation &authorInfo ) : MonoDevelop.VersionControl.CommitMessageFormat
cset MonoDevelop.VersionControl.ChangeSet
authorInfo MonoDevelop.Projects.AuthorInformation
return MonoDevelop.VersionControl.CommitMessageFormat

GetCommitMessageFormat() public static method

public static GetCommitMessageFormat ( MonoDevelop.Projects.SolutionFolderItem item ) : MonoDevelop.VersionControl.CommitMessageFormat
item MonoDevelop.Projects.SolutionFolderItem
return MonoDevelop.VersionControl.CommitMessageFormat

GetProgressMonitor() public static method

public static GetProgressMonitor ( string operation ) : MonoDevelop.Core.ProgressMonitor
operation string
return MonoDevelop.Core.ProgressMonitor

GetProgressMonitor() public static method

public static GetProgressMonitor ( string operation, VersionControlOperationType op ) : MonoDevelop.Core.ProgressMonitor
operation string
op VersionControlOperationType
return MonoDevelop.Core.ProgressMonitor

GetRepositories() static public method

static public GetRepositories ( ) : IEnumerable
return IEnumerable

GetRepository() public static method

public static GetRepository ( WorkspaceObject entry ) : Repository
entry WorkspaceObject
return Repository

GetRepositoryReference() public static method

public static GetRepositoryReference ( string path, string id ) : Repository
path string
id string
return Repository

GetStatusLabel() public static method

public static GetStatusLabel ( VersionStatus status ) : string
status VersionStatus
return string

GetVersionControlSystems() static public method

static public GetVersionControlSystems ( ) : IEnumerable
return IEnumerable

IsSolutionDisabled() public static method

public static IsSolutionDisabled ( Solution it ) : bool
it Solution
return bool

LoadIconForStatus() public static method

public static LoadIconForStatus ( VersionStatus status ) : Xwt.Drawing.Image
status VersionStatus
return Xwt.Drawing.Image

LoadOverlayIconForStatus() public static method

public static LoadOverlayIconForStatus ( VersionStatus status ) : Xwt.Drawing.Image
status VersionStatus
return Xwt.Drawing.Image

NotifyFileStatusChanged() public static method

public static NotifyFileStatusChanged ( MonoDevelop.VersionControl.FileUpdateEventArgs args ) : void
args MonoDevelop.VersionControl.FileUpdateEventArgs
return void

NotifyFileStatusChanged() public static method

public static NotifyFileStatusChanged ( IEnumerable items ) : void
items IEnumerable
return void

RemoveRepository() public static method

public static RemoveRepository ( Repository repo ) : void
repo Repository
return void

ResetConfiguration() public static method

public static ResetConfiguration ( ) : void
return void

SaveConfiguration() public static method

public static SaveConfiguration ( ) : void
return void

SetSolutionDisabled() public static method

public static SetSolutionDisabled ( Solution it, bool value ) : void
it Solution
value bool
return void